Crochet Fan Stitch Baby Blanket.
This beautiful and soft baby blanket is crocheted in Drops baby merino, which is a super soft and 100% scratch-free yarn that is perfect for baby blankets. It is also super wash treated and can be washed directly in the machine. Which is super practical for a baby blanket that is used daily.
The pattern in which this blanket is made, is surprisingly easy , and it is also quite quick to make, as it is worked in double crochet stitches with a 3.5 mm. crochet hook. Materials
Gauge
Fan Stitch – 21 ST and 9 Rows = 10 x 10 cm.
HDC – 21 ST = 10 cm.
Abbreviations
- ST – Stitch
- CH – Chain
- SL ST- Slip stitch
- DC- Double crochet
- V-ST- V-Stitch (1 DC+ 1 CH + 1 DC)
- HDC- Half double crochet
Pattern Notes
- Measurements: 72 x 94 cm.
- Skill level: Easy
- The pattern is written in US Crochet terms.
Instructions
CH 168 + 5
Row 1. Skip the first 4 ch and make a dc in the 5th ch from the hook (the ch 4 and dc counts as the first V-st). *Skip 3 ch. Make 5 dc in the next ch. Skip 3 ch. Make a V-st into the next ch*. Repeat the pattern from *-* across the row. Make a V-st in the last ch.
Row 2. Ch 3 and turn (ch 3 will count as a dc). Make 2 dc into the V-st from the previous row. *Skip 3 st. Make a V-st. Skip 3 st. Make 5 dc into the next V-stitch.* Repeat the pattern from *-* across the row. Make 3 dc into the last V-st.
Row 3. Ch 4. Dc into the first st (the ch 4 and dc counts as the first V-st). *Skip 3 st. Make 5 dc into the next V-st. Skip 3 st. Make a V-stitch*. Repeat the pattern from *-* across the row. Make a V-st in the last st.
Row 4-89. Repeat rows 2 and 3.
The Border
Round 1-3. Ch 1 and Make a round of Hdc all the way around your blanket. Make 3 Hdc into every one of the four corners of your blanket. Sl st into the first st and ch 1.

If I wanted to make a wider blanket, what is the multiple?
Thanks!
Hi 🙂
The multiple is 8+5
